I have a 2006 Lexus GS430 and need to put a new rack & pinion in. All the ones I am seeing online are for vehicles with electric steering and without sway bar control......how do I know if my vehicle has sway bar control or not when ordering a new rack & pinion?

Probably best to phone your local lexus dealer and give them your vin number. Ask them for the part number, and from there you can cross reference the difference or the parts guy may know the difference.

Maybe it has to do with apsss (active power stabilizer suspension system) maybe you can crawl under your car and look at your front swaybar. If it is a standard swaybar then you dont have the apsss, I think it has some sort of torsion motor attached to the center of the bar, that senses a vehicles turn and adjusts the suspension. Pretty sure it is a super rare option

Active stabilizer suspension was available on 2007 GS430 and 2008-2011 GS460 in North America.

2006 GS430's and GS300/350's did not offer the option.
